Classification, Compensation & Recruitment Fair Labor Standard Act (FLSA) Established in 1938 The FLSA s basic requirements are: Payment of minimum wage Overtime pay for time worked over 40 hours in a workweek Record keeping

Access & Equity American with Disabilities Act Civil Rights Law with the purpose of eliminating discrimination against qualified individual with disabilities
Access & Equity What is Sexual Harassment? Unwelcome sexual advances or request for sexual favors Verbal or physical conduct of a sexual nature Written communication of an intimidating, hostile or offensive nature
Access & Equity When Does Sexual Harassment Occur? When submission is made a term or condition of employment Used as a basis for employment decisions Conduct interferes unreasonably with work or creates an intimidating, hostile or offensive working environment
